Description
Nos 13 and 15 on Willow Street are early 19th-century buildings constructed of red brick. They rise three storeys and feature three sash windows. Both properties have identical coupled wooden doorcases set beneath a shallow pediment, all located within a slightly recessed bay that is arched at the second storey. Number 13 includes a rectangular bay window with a shallow pediment. The buildings have corbelled eaves and are topped with slate roofing. To the left side, there is a segmental-headed carriage arch. At the rear, the buildings incorporate a 17th-century single-storey outbuilding, which has some exposed timber-framing on its north side.
